Homer Pierce Clark, son of Charles Henry Clark (1836-1907) and Martha Cowper Pierce Clark (1837-1929), was born in Boston, Massachusetts, April 6, 1868. He was graduated from St. Paul (Minnesota) High School in 1887 and received a Bachelor of Laws degree from the University of Minnesota Law School in 1894, being admitted to the bar in that year. He began his career as a clerk with Finch, Van Slyck and McConville Wholesale Dry Goods Company of St. Paul in 1888. In 1890, he became associated with West Publishing Company, at which he was appointed treasurer in 1902, president in 1921, and chairman of the board in 1932. Under his leadership the company developed into the nation’s largest publisher of law books. He retired in 1950. Clark died October 7, 1970, and is buried in Roselawn Cemetery (Roseville, Minnesota).
Clark was very involved in the business life of St. Paul and Minnesota. He served on the board of directors of Waldorf Paper Products Company (also serving as president), the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is, and the St. Paul Fire and Marine Insurance Company. He was vice chair of the Liberty Loan Committee during World War I, was instrumental in the construction and operation of the James J. Hill Reference Library in St Paul and was active in the St. Paul Community Chest. His interests also included the civic, political, and cultural affairs of the city and state. He was honorary chair of the American Law Book Company and was a member of the American Bar Association, the Minnesota State Bar Association, the Minnesota Historical Society, and the Mayflower Society.
On January 12, 1910, Clark married Elizabeth Turner Dunsmoor (1886-1977). They made their home on Summit Avenue in St. Paul and were the parents of five children: Robert Stuart Clark (1917-1943), Thomas Kimball Clark (1921-1959), Elizabeth Turner Clark (b. 1924), Dr. Catherine Pierce Clark Kroeger (1925-2011), and Helen Dunsmoor Clark (b. 1928). His sister, Mary Barnard Clark (1871-1963) married Charles Henry Putnam (1868-1908).

The collection contains information about organizations with which Clark was involved, including West Publishing Company (president, 1921-1932) and chairman (1932-1950); Waldorf Paper Products Company (director); the James Jerome Hill Reference Library (trustee); the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is (director); the St. Paul Fire and Marine Insurance Company (director); and the Minnesota Historical Society (executive council). There are letters written by William Henry Harrison, John Quincy Adams, Henry Wadsworth Longfellow, and J.H. Payne; minutes of the Minnesota State Veterans Service Building Commission (Clark served on the commission from 1947 to 1966); and financial statements and reports of three Hoerner Waldorf-related companies. Correspondents include business associates, family members, banks and insurance companies, and a variety of other individuals.
